Job Description :
Function : Software Engineering Full-Stack Development
JavaScript React.js Node.js Vue.js TypeScript
Responsibilities :
- Develop and maintain highly optimized JavaScript tags for embedding on client websites.
- Ensure seamless integration and efficient performance of dynamic content generation on landing pages.
- Implement strategies to minimize the payload and execution time of JavaScript tags to enhance page load speed and responsiveness.
- Design and maintain robust caching mechanisms to ensure that components are served instantly and meet the required SLAs for websites.
- Collaborate with backend developers to ensure efficient data flow and processing.
- Implement and maintain backend services to process data and retrieve resources from the vector database.
- Work closely with UI / UX designers to implement design specifications.
Requirements :
Bachelor's degree in Computer Science, Engineering, or a related field.Minimum 3 years of experience as a Full Stack Developer or Front End Developer.Experience with front-end frameworks like React, Angular, or Vue.js .Strong knowledge of back-end technologies such as Node.js, Express, or similar.Strong problem-solving skills and attention to detail.Excellent communication and teamwork abilities.Bonus Points :
Experience with B2B tools or SaaS products.Familiarity with RESTful APIs and integrating front-end with back-end services.Knowledge of modern build tools and version control systems like Git.Experience with database management, particularly vector databases.(ref : hirist.tech)